Wireshark is a packet analyzer. It captures data packets traveling back and forth on a network interface and displays them in an incredibly detailed, human-readable format. Whether you’re troubleshooting a slow Wi-Fi connection, investigating a security breach, or learning how the TCP handshake works, Wireshark gives you a microscopic view of your network traffic.

Originally named Ethereal (created by Gerald Combs in 1998), the tool was later renamed to Wireshark. Today, it is actively maintained by a global team of volunteers and sponsored by several tech companies, all while remaining open-source under the GNU General Public License (GPL).
